Township Resident Swindled In Bitcoin Gambit

A township resident told police on May 3 that they had been swindled out of more than $107,000. The person told police that they met the suspect, possibly an Asian woman, on a dating website. Willingboro Man Charged With Theft Of $9,300 In Lottery Tickets

A 41-year-old Willingboro man was charged April 4 with stealing $9,300 worth of lottery tickets from an Easton Avenue convenience store. Police were called to the store shortly after 8 a.m. on March 14. The investigation determined that someone broke the store’s glass door the night before and gained entry into the business. Police: Township Resident Scammed Out Of $600,000

A township resident was scammed out of more than $600,000 earlier this month, police said. The resident, who was not named, told police on March 6 that he received a phone call, ostensibly from the Franklin Township Police Department, from a person who described himself as a U.S. Customs Agent.
